1871 Cornwall Census

Parish ST BREWARD; District 5; Schedule 064

~ Mary GEAKE was the mother of Mary Geake (Jr) who married Edward Charles MANICOM ~

NAME Position in Family Marital Status Age
GEAKE, Mary Head W 58

More Information on Above Names

NAME Occupation Approx Birth Year Birthplace
GEAKE, Mary Laundress 1813 Otterham Cornwall

Parish ST BREWARD; District 5; Schedule 054

~ Jane GEAKE was the daughter of Mary Sr and the younger sister of Mary Jr ~

NAME Position in Family Marital Status Age
GEAKE, Jane Servant U 20

More Information on Above Names

NAME Occupation Approx Birth Year Birthplace
GEAKE, Jane Cook. Dom 1851 Davidstow Cornwall

CHURCHTOWN, St Breward

GEAICE, Mary Head W 68 Annuitant born Otterham
**GEAICE, Jane Dau U 30 Farmer's Dau born St Breward
*MANICOM, William GSon 13 Scholar born St Breward
*MANICOM, James GSon 11 Scholar born St Breward
*MANICOM, Elizabeth GDau Scholar born St Breward

** JANE is shown living at home again, so her position in the 1871 Census with another family
as 'cook/domestic' must have terminated!!


* Mary GEAKE's grandchildren William, James & Elizabeth
(parents were Edward Charles MANICOM and her daughter Mary GEAKE Jr)
are shown living with their grandmother ..... this was because Edward and Mary both died very young!


* William Geake MANICOM, grandson, later married Elizabeth Ann HOOPER, also of Cornwall.
* James MANICOM, grandson, died relatively young.
*Elizabeth MANICOM, granddaughter, later married a Mr. GREENWAY.
